Output f6e603ddc42923376e24781fcdb1d705802e6e8c8e074a6428cc8b8caaf12f04:3

value
32253
script pubkey
OP_0 OP_PUSHBYTES_20 8681d0317e58fba8acf6d46165eeb91aad29a0f9
address
bc1qs6qaqvt7tra63t8k63sktm4er2kjng8e4xk8ad
transaction
f6e603ddc42923376e24781fcdb1d705802e6e8c8e074a6428cc8b8caaf12f04